In brief

Security researchers have discovered ENDLESSDOORS, a critical remote access vulnerability affecting over 20 Zbtlink router models manufactured in China. This sophisticated backdoor enables unauthorized attackers to gain root-level access and execute arbitrary commands, while establishing persistent command-and-control communications at regular 35-second intervals. The vulnerability poses significant risks to home and business networks, potentially compromising sensitive data and network integrity. Users of affected devices are urged to investigate their router models and implement immediate security measures.
